How Tnpsc Image Compressor Systems Function
Advanced compression technologies rely on mathematical algorithms to reduce file size. Tools such as Tnpsc photo compress often utilize lossy or lossless compression techniques.
Lossy optimization minimizes file weight by discarding less critical Tnpsc image compressor visual information. Lossless techniques maintain image integrity while improving efficiency.
Different compression styles are selected based on upload requirements and quality expectations. Gaming platforms often prefer balanced optimization for speed and clarity.
